PROPERTY
The property is accessed from the front into a welcoming entrance hall which leads through to the large living room with feature fireplace. There is an opening through to the dining room which provides further reception space and access to the conservatory. The kitchen/breakfast room is fitted with a range of storage and appliance space as well as a breakfast bar, whilst the utility provides further storage and appliance space. A further room can be used as an additional reception room or fifth ground floor bedroom if required. The ground floor is completed by a 'Jack and Jill' style wet room which makes an ensuite for bedroom 5, or useful downstairs cloakroom with shower. The first floor landing provides access to the four good size bedrooms and the family bathroom which comprises a bath with shower over, wc, and wash hand basin. The master bedroom benefits from a built in wardrobe and ensuite fitted with a suite comprising shower, wc, and wash hand basin.
GARDENS
To the front of the property is a large block paved driveway and area of gravel which is enclosed by a low wall and provides parking for several vehicles. To the rear is an enclosed garden with gated access from the rear which has areas of lawn, patio, gravel and borders. There is access to a large workshop/storage room with light and power.
LOCATION
The property is situated in a quiet close which forms part of this popular development in this sought after residential area and provides easy access to the many amenities of this desirable town. Cricklade is conveniently situated between Cirencester and Swindon and offers easy access to the nearby road and rail network.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
